plc编程语言

时间:2025-01-28 17:07:25 网络游戏

在PLC编程中,T型图通常指的是 梯形图(Ladder Diagram, LD),它是一种图形化的编程语言,用于描述控制系统中输入和输出之间的逻辑关系。梯形图借鉴了继电器控制电路的符号,因此具有形象、直观、实用的特点。下面是一些关于如何阅读和理解梯形图的基本要点:

左母线和右母线

左母线通常代表正极,而右母线代表负极。在梯形图中,这两条线不一定每次都显示,但理解它们有助于形成电路的回路概念。

触点和指令

梯形图中的每个触点通常对应一个PLC输入或输出。例如,X000可能表示一个输入继电器,Y000表示一个输出继电器。

指令如LD(Load,取指令)和OUT(Output,输出指令)用于控制触点的状态和输出信号的驱动。

梯级和电路块

梯形图由多个梯级组成,每个梯级代表一个逻辑运算步骤。

电路块是由两个或两个以上的触点串联或并联组成的,这在梯形图中通过将触点连接在一起来表示。

定时器(Timer)

在梯形图中,T通常用来表示计时器(Timer)。例如,T0可能表示一个定时器,用于设定一个时间长度。

定时器可以与其他条件一起判断是否满足触发条件,从而控制程序的执行流程。

编程规则和可读性

编写梯形图时,应遵守基本的编程规则,确保程序结构的逻辑清晰性。

代码的可维护性和可读性也非常重要,这有助于其他开发者理解和修改程序。

通过以上几点,可以更好地理解和阅读PLC梯形图。建议在实际编程中,多练习和参考现有的梯形图示例,以加深对梯形图编程语言的理解和应用。